WebTo find the cumulative probability of a z-score equal to -1.21, cross-reference the row containing -1.2 of the table with the column holding 0.01. The table explains that the probability that a standard normal random variable will be less than -1.21 is 0.1131; that is, P(Z < -1.21) = 0.1131. Web22 jan. 2024 · Follow the instruction below to find the probability from the table. Here, z-score = 2.44. Firstly, map the first two digits 2.4 on the Y-axis. Then along the X-axis, map 0.04; Join both axes. The intersection of the two will provide you the Z-Score value you’re looking for; As a result, you will get the final value which is 0.99266. WebA z-score measures exactly how many standard deviations above or below the mean a data point is.
